Utility & Regulated Industry Integration Program
 
Engagement Overview
 
Need 5โ€“6 senior middleware engineers to staff a large, regulated utility client's enterprise integration program, spanning grid operations technology (OT), smart meter/AMI data, outage management, billing, and enterprise IT (ERP/CRM). This is a mission-critical integration workstream operating under NERC CIP and related utility regulatory requirements. Engagement is structured 60% onsite (US) and 40% offshore (India), onshore-led with offshore-leveraged delivery. Client identity is confidential for external-facing postings; refer to it as "a Fortune 500 regulated utility client."
 
Key Responsibilities
* Design, build, and maintain middleware integration layers connecting OT systems (SCADA, smart meter/AMI, outage management) with enterprise IT (billing, CRM, SAP/ERP, data warehouse).
* Implement and operate enterprise integration platforms โ€” MuleSoft, IBM webMethods/IIB, TIBCO, Dell Boomi, or Azure Integration Services (platform per candidate specialization).
* Build and maintain REST/SOAP APIs, event-driven architectures, and message queues (Kafka, IBM MQ, RabbitMQ) for real-time and batch data exchange.
* Ensure integration security, reliability, and compliance with NERC CIP and other utility regulatory standards.
* Modernize and troubleshoot legacy-to-modern integrations, including mainframe and SAP PI/PO connections.
* Partner with grid operations, billing, customer service, and data teams to translate business requirements into integration architecture.
* Produce architecture and data-flow documentation sufficient for audit and regulatory review.
Required Qualifications
* 12+ years of middleware/integration engineering experience, with demonstrable delivery in utilities or another regulated industry (financial services, healthcare, energy).
* Hands-on expertise in at least one major enterprise integration platform: MuleSoft, IBM webMethods, TIBCO, Boomi, or Azure Logic Apps/Integration Services.
* Direct experience integrating OT/SCADA or IoT/AMI systems with enterprise IT โ€” non-negotiable for this utility environment.
* Strong API design (REST/SOAP) and event-streaming/message-queue experience (Kafka, RabbitMQ, IBM MQ).
* Working knowledge of regulatory/compliance frameworks relevant to utilities (NERC CIP) or equivalent regulated-industry standards.
* Bachelorโ€™s degree in computer science, Engineering, or related field, or equivalent hands-on experience.
